French Bisque Kid-Bodied Bebe by Andre Thuillier

Description
21" (53 cm). Pressed bisque swivel head on kid-edged bisque shoulderplate, plumply modeled cheeks and chin, blue glass paperweight inset eyes, dark eyeliner encircles the eyecut, painted lashes, incised eyeliner, mauve blushed eyeshadow, brushstroked and multi-feathered brows, accented eye corners, shaded nostrils, closed mouth with modeled definition between the shaded and outlined lips, impressed dimples at philtrum and lip corners, pierced ears, original French kid gusset-jointed bebe body, bisque hands with individually sculpted fingers and detailed knuckles and nails, antique costume of cream gown with lace and satin trim, undergarments, lace and silk bonnet, shoes and stockings. Condition: generally excellent. Marks: A 9 T. Comments: Andre Thuillier, circa 1882. Value Points: exquisite modeling of the face and hands of the early model bebe, superb quality of bisque and painting, very sturdy original body, lovely antique costume.
